description Wharfedale Diamond 12.1 Overview
The Wharfedale Diamond 12.1 continues the legendary Diamond series tradition of musical, natural sound at an affordable price. It uses a 5-inch woven Kevlar cone woofer and a 1-inch soft dome tweeter, delivering a balanced, cohesive sound with excellent midrange clarity. The 12.1 is known for its smooth, non-fatiguing character that flatters most genres, especially jazz, classical, and vocals. Cabinet construction features a braced design to reduce resonance.
At $399 per pair, its a serious contender for those seeking a refined, neutral speaker that works in smaller rooms.
help Wharfedale Diamond 12.1 FAQ
Do the Wharfedale Diamond 12.1 speakers need a separate amplifier?
Yes, the Wharfedale Diamond 12.1 are passive bookshelf speakers and require an external amplifier or AV receiver to operate. They work well with entry-level amps in the 25-75 watt per channel range.
What drivers are in the Wharfedale Diamond 12.1?
The Diamond 12.1 uses a 5-inch woven Kevlar cone woofer paired with a 1-inch soft dome tweeter. This driver combination delivers a balanced sound signature with particularly strong midrange clarity.
How do the Diamond 12.1 speakers compare to the previous Diamond 11.1 generation?
The Diamond 12.1 features a redesigned cabinet and updated Kevlar woofer compared to the Diamond 11.1, offering improved cabinet rigidity and refined dispersion. Most reviewers note a more cohesive soundstage and tighter bass in the 12.1 generation.
Are the Wharfedale Diamond 12.1 good for near-field desktop listening?
While the Diamond 12.1 can work on a desk, their rear-firing port and 5-inch woofer are better suited for small-to-medium room placement on stands. For near-field desktop use, you may want to consider smaller speakers like the Diamond 12.0 instead.
